Obsah:
Definice - Co znamená Middleware?
Middleware je softwarová vrstva umístěná mezi aplikacemi a operačními systémy. Middleware se obvykle používá v distribuovaných systémech, kde zjednodušuje vývoj softwaru následujícím postupem:
- Skryje složitosti distribuovaných aplikací
- Skryje heterogenitu hardwaru, operačních systémů a protokolů
- Poskytuje jednotná a vysoce kvalitní rozhraní používaná k vytváření interoperabilních, opakovaně použitelných a přenosných aplikací
- Poskytuje řadu běžných služeb, které minimalizují duplicitu úsilí a zlepšují spolupráci mezi aplikacemi
Techopedia vysvětluje Middleware
Middleware je podobný operačnímu systému, protože může podporovat jiné aplikační programy, poskytovat řízenou interakci, zabránit rušení mezi výpočty a usnadnit interakci mezi výpočty na různých počítačích prostřednictvím síťových komunikačních služeb.
Typický operační systém poskytuje aplikační programovací rozhraní (API) pro programy využívající základní hardwarové funkce. Middleware však poskytuje API pro využití základních funkcí operačního systému.
